CREAMY GUACAMOLE SALSA (LIKE MAMA NINFA'S)



Creamy Guacamole Salsa (like Mama Ninfa's) image

A creamy guacamole salsa that's a mashup of guacamole and salsa verde. This is the famous Mama Ninfa's green sauce recipe tweaked to give it more of a flavor punch!

Number Of Ingredients 8

½ lb. green tomatoes, roughly chopped
½ lb. tomatillos, husk removed and roughly chopped
3-4 cloves garlic
1-2 jalapenos (seeds removed for a milder flavor)
2 medium avocados
¼ cup cilantro leaves and stems
½ cup sour cream (or greek yogurt)
2-4 tablespoons lime juice (to taste)

Steps:

  • cook: add the ingredients to a medium saucepan over medium-high heat along with a big pinch of salt and stir to combine. When you hear it start to sizzle, lower the heat to medium-low and let it cook for 12-15 minutes or until everything softens. If around the 10-minute mark you see a lot of liquid leftover in the pan, kick the heat up to medium-high to help evaporate all the liquid, stirring as needed to prevent sticking. Allow the mixture to cool for 20 minutes before proceeding.
  • blend: add the avocados, cooled tomatillo mixture, and cilantro to a food processor and pulse until smooth. Add the sour cream and continue to mix until it reaches a mostly smooth consistency. Drizzle in a couple tablespoons of lime juice and pulse to combine. Taste and adjust with additional lime juice and salt as desired. Pour the guacamole salsa into a bowl, cover and refrigerate for at least 3 hours before serving.

NINFA'S GREEN SAUCE



Ninfa's Green Sauce image

This green sauce is popular in many Mexican restaurants around Houston. Ninfa's was one of the first to serve this sauce. The recipe has been printed in the Houston Chronicle several times. I've adapted it slightly. Mama Ninfa Rodriquez Laurenzo opened the original Ninfa's Restaurant on Navigation street in 1973. Her food differed from the usual Tex-Mex restaurants in town. She seemed to achieve fame in the kitchen overnight. Some of her famous guests included George Bush, Michael Douglas, John Travolta, Rock Hudson, and Aerosmith! Mama Ninfa lost her battle with cancer last year, but her much loved Mexican food lives on. The original Ninfa's is still there, and there are several other locations here in Houston as well.

Number Of Ingredients 8

3 medium avocados
3 medium green tomatoes
4 fresh tomatillos
3 garlic cloves
3 sprigs fresh cilantro
2 -3 jalapenos
1 1/2 cups sour cream
1/2 teaspoon salt, to taste

Steps:

  • Peel avocados and place them in a blender.
  • In a medium saucepan, boil tomates, tomatillos, garlic, and jalapenos for 15 minutes.
  • Remove from saucepan and place all ingredients in a blender with avocados.
  • Add sour cream and blend until smooth.

NINFA'S AVOCADO SAUCE



Ninfa's Avocado Sauce image

When I was growing up in Houston, there was a wonderful restaurant in our neighborhood called Ninfa's. Our favorite sauce was the Avocado Sauce that they put on the table.

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 ripe avocado
1/4 cup sour cream
1/4 cup milk
1 teaspoon minced onion
1 garlic clove, mashed to a pulp with 1/4 teaspoon of salt
1 tablespoon of minced fresh cilantro (or 1/4 teaspoon of dry)
1/2 teaspoon hot pepper sauce
6 tablespoons lemon juice

Steps:

  • Peel the Avocado and smash to a smooth pulp. Add the remaining ingredients and blend with a wire whip. Let stand for at least an hour before serving.
  • Increase to taste garlic, cilantro or pepper sauce.

NINFA'S GREEN TOMATO SALSA



Ninfa's Green Tomato Salsa image

A famous green salsa recipe in Houston. Guaranteed to be loved by all.

Number Of Ingredients 8

3 green tomatoes, chopped
4 fresh tomatillos - husked, rinsed, and chopped
1 jalapeno pepper, chopped
3 small garlic cloves
3 avocados - peeled, pitted, and sliced
4 sprigs cilantro
1 teaspoon salt
1 ½ cups sour cream

Steps:

  • Stir tomatoes, tomatillos, jalapeno pepper, and garlic together in a saucepan; bring to a boil, reduce heat to low, and cook at a simmer until the tomatoes and tomatillos soften, 10 to 15 minutes. Remove saucepan from heat and let tomato mixture cool slightly.
  • Pour cooled tomato mixture into a blender pitcher; add avocado slices, cilantro, and salt. Blend the mixture until smooth; transfer to a bowl.
  • Stir sour cream into the blended mixture until smooth.
